Output ef7882125250db0a4a7b5c29d91001b9077d10b7cd16e848e02fc74cbefe8908:1

value
694200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18d982d5580b18568c6debd96f5f5472f57f7e28 OP_EQUAL
address
33xQi5gr4oiQZ9xt9keWVVbw1inqXEiq6b
transaction
ef7882125250db0a4a7b5c29d91001b9077d10b7cd16e848e02fc74cbefe8908
spent
true